Output 5f17bd8b03a9f076597ff0f7265432475b31177bbb01624ba7ae2f6c96f3bd02:24

value
322950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2640fc9cfc12ef626745f70456c91a5ba04883f OP_EQUAL
address
3LsThEb3rdHtH9d1jfHG78LmMnuUjesJzA
transaction
5f17bd8b03a9f076597ff0f7265432475b31177bbb01624ba7ae2f6c96f3bd02
confirmations
122855
spent
true